The soft skills training is now a part of almost every course and they are also called employability skills. While you may be excellent in project, designing and techical aspect, if you are not able to pitch in your idea to investors the whole degree becomes useless. Hence, the soft skills like communication, teamwork and collaboration, critical thinking, problem solving, adaptability, conflict management, emotional stability all comes under the gamut of soft skills.

Studying abroad without no fees is very hard to find. You must bear the living expenses atleast. Poland and Germany are two countries having no or low tuition fees but international students must pay a minimal fee. You must check university websites for details and fee structure.
